What Are Energy-Saving Windows?
Energy-saving windows, also referred to as energy-efficient windows, are designed to minimize the amount of energy used for heating and cooling homes. They are characterized by a number of essential features, consisting of double or triple glazing, low-emissivity (Low-E) coatings, and gas fills between the panes. These windows provide enhanced insulation and assist manage indoor temperature levels by reducing the transfer of heat and cold.

There are several kinds of energy-saving windows to consider, each with distinct functions and benefits:
1. Double and Triple Glazed Windows
Double-glazed windows have two panes of glass with a space between them, while triple-glazed windows have three. The layer of air or gas in between function as insulation, lowering heat transfer.
2. Low-E Windows
Low-E (low-emissivity) windows have a special covering that reflects infrared light (keeping heat inside) while enabling visible light to travel through. This increases energy effectiveness without compromising natural light.
3. Gas-Filled Windows
These windows use argon or krypton gas between the panes to improve insulation. The gas fill has a lower thermal conductivity than air, enhancing energy performance.
4. Frames Made from Energy-Efficient Materials
Frame materials like vinyl, fiberglass, or composite products are much better insulators than aluminum, assisting to reduce heat loss.
Picking the Right Energy-Saving Windows
When picking energy-saving windows, consider the list below elements:
Climate: Different windows may perform better in various climates. For instance, warmer areas may gain from windows that show heat, while colder regions might require windows that keep heat.Energy Ratings: Look for windows with high rankings from ENERGY STAR or the National Fenestration Rating Council (NFRC).Visual Considerations: Choose window styles and styles that match your home while still maximizing energy performance.Installation: Proper installation is critical for attaining the full benefits of energy-efficient windows.
